About This Piece

Vintage Design

Rare pair of wall lights from an old cinema projection room.

The long reflectors made it possible to reduce the scattering of the light even further, and more targeted lighting was possible. The front closure glasses also make it possible to install filter glasses to avoid white light.

Manufactured by the Industriewerke Auma in the 1930s.
The lights have lived a lifetime together and have aged about the same. They have a blue / gray hammerite finish.

The scissor pulls run fine and are adjustable. The effective range is 40cm - 95cm.
Both lights were dismantled, cleaned and re-electrified with textile cables. The integrated tumbler switches switch perfectly.

Slight color losses, rust spots and nickel peeling are present in both lights.
Remember - they'll be 100 years old soon.

About the Creator

Curt Fischer

Curt Fischer (1890-1956)  was a German industrial designer and engineer who is credited with inventing directional light with the first articulated, steerable light. Fischer’s designs were a particular inspiration to the seminal designer-architect Walter Gropius and the Bauhaus school, which laid the foundations of modernist design and architecture.

No biographical information is available on Fischer’s formative years and education, however it is known that Fischer worked as an engineer at IWA (Industriewerk Auma), a factory which produced metal parts and tools  for the production of industrial porcelain. Up until the 1920s, the only available factory lighting was ceiling-mounted pendants, which provided static light and often casted unwanted shadows. Even before well known desk lamp designs by Christian Dell or Marianne Brandt were conceived, Fischer realized there was a need for flexible lighting in industrial settings. Originally designed to use at IWA,  Fischer created a light that could be articulated and steered. The first prototype, which Fischer sketched and made himself, featured articulated tubes in which the cable could pass and bend freely. In 1919, he established the lighting brand Midgard as a subsection of IWA, which was newly acquired by Fischer. Originally designed to use at IWA, the Scissor Lamp (1919), which was patented on November 26, 1919, featured articulated tubes in which the cable could pass and bend freely. In 1922, Fischer designed the first glare-free reflector, which was rotatable and asymmetrical. The reflector ensured optimal directed light and protected the eyes of the factory worker using the light.

Fischer’s lights were used in industrial settings including on ships, in workshops, and in the private sector. Walter Gropius admired Fischer and was an active supporter of his experimental products. Gropius used Midgard lights in the living room of his house at the Dessau Bauhaus. The metal workshop at the Weimar Bauhaus was illuminated with Midgard lights and served as a model for the students’ designs.

Curt Fischer’s collection for Midgard includes the scissor-like 112 Trellis Wall Light (1922); the 113 Table Light (c. 1925), which is also known as the Whip Lamp due to its curved stem; the articulated 114 Hinge Lamp (1920s); the Machine Lamp (1930s) which features patented, maintenance-free joints; and the Spring-Loaded Lamp (1950s).

Fischer passed away in 1956.

Today, Midgard is owned by David Einsiedler and Joke Rasch, founders of of the Hamburg-based furniture company PLY, who continue to produce Fischer’s original designs. 

About the Maker

Midgard / Industriewerke Auma

German lighting manufacturer Midgard was founded in 1919 in Auma, Thuringia by industrial designer and engineer Curt Fischer (1890-1956). The company is known for producing the first articulated directional light designed by Fischer himself, which inspired a whole future generation of multifunctional task lights.

Fischer was an engineer for the machine factory Industriewerk Auma (IWA), which had originally produced machines for the production of industrial porcelain. In 1919, Fischer took over IWA, adding “Ronneberger and Fischer” to the factory’s name in memory of Konrad Ronneberger, who had founded the factory in 1912 and died in the First World War.  Until the 1920s, the only available factory lighting was ceiling-mounted pendants, which provided static light and often casted unwanted shadows. Realizing there was a need for flexible lighting in industrial settings, Fischer created a light that could be articulated and steered in the direction of a factory worker’s desk or station. Originally designed for use at IWA, the Scissor Lamp (1919), which was patented on November 26, 1919, featured articulated tubes that allowed a cable to pass through and bend freely. In 1922, Fischer designed and added a glare-free reflector, which was rotatable and asymmetrical. The reflector ensured optimal directed light and protected the eyes of the factory worker using it.

In 1925, the first catalog was published with seven different styles of wall-mounted lamps available. By 1927, the catalog features of twenty different styles of lights. Notable lights produced by Midgard include the scissor-like 112 Trellis Wall Light (1922); the 113 Table Light (c. 1925), also known as the Whip Lamp because of the shape of the stem; the articulated 114 Hinge Lamp (1920s); the Machine Lamp (1930s) which features patented, maintenance-free joints; and the Spring-Loaded Lamp (1950s).

Walter Gropius admired Fischer and his designs, and was an active supporter of Fischer’s developments. The metal workshop at the Weimar Bauhaus was lit with Midgard lights and served as a model for the students’ designs. Gropius had Midgard lights his own living room at the Dessau Bauhaus.

Having continued production during and after the War, Fischer passed away in 1956, leaving the company to his son Wolfgang (b. 1924) who managed Midgard until the 1960s.

Located in East Germany, Midgard was expropriated in 1972 and the company was restructured and renamed VEB Industrieleuchtenbau Auma. VEB was the prefix given to all companies that were nationalized en masse in the socialist era. The company became the largest lighting manufacturer in East Germany, exporting to multinational retailers such as IKEA. Following the fall of the wall and the reunification of Germany in 1990, the company was re-privatized and returned to Wolfgang in the early 1990s, who reinstated the company’s original name. Although Midgard’s product line remained the same, Wolfgang worked on updating and improving the collection of desk lamps. From 2002 until 2008, Wolfgang’s step-daughters, Anja Specht and Susi Reifenstahl, joined the company, and reintroduced the classic Steering Lamp, including models 113 and 114. In 2011, all production ceased due to infrastructural problems.

In 2015, David Einsiedler and Joke Rasch - the founders of the Hamburg-based furniture company PLY - took over the company. In addition to all licensing rights to the Midgard task lamps, they also acquired the original tools, and Midgard’s exhaustive archive of original documents. The company relocated to Hamburg, where the production line was rebuilt, modernized, and put into operation in 2017. Today, Midgard continues to produce three classic Midgard lamps: the Steering Lamp, Machine Lamp, and Spring Loaded Lamp, with authentic vintage Midgard lamps also in demand by collectors.
